The role you'll contribute:
Performs Direct patient care activities that are developmental and age specific for the population served; coordinates, supervises and directs those providing care at a novice and advanced beginner level. The Registered Nurse is under the supervision of the Nurse Manager and the assigned charge nurses. This care is consistent with the hospital accountabilities, Standards of Practice and in support of the Nursing Service and patient care goals. Actual roles and tasks may vary depending upon the unit or department assigned.
The value you'll bring to the team:
• Adheres to the policies and procedures as related to the clinical area.
• Responsible for the application of guidelines and standards in accordance with current practices.
• Patient Care activities include, but not limited to:
o Prioritizing work utilizing the Electronic Medical Record
o Reviews medical record to assess needs
o Completing assessments, and data histories
o Instructs/educates patients and/or significant other, documents properly
o Provide adequate supplies according to patient needs
o Provides patient care in a safe manner utilizing evidence based practice for quality outcomes
• Has knowledge of and understands current TJC Standards for the clinical aspect of the department.
• Manages time effectively.
• Acts in patient's best interest as the patient's advocate and promotes teamwork with physicians and all health care providers
Qualifications
The expertise and experiences you'll need to succeed :
E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E REQUIRED:
• Current nursing licensure (RN) in the State of Texas
• Current BLS certification
• One (1) year medical-surgical and/or ER nursing experience recommended. One (1) year related experience in field applied for, or Internship/preceptor shop for new graduates required
